Upaya Meningkatkan Partisipasi dan Hasil Belajar Materi Pertumbuhan dan Perkembangan Makhluk Hidup melalui Penerapan Model Pembelajaran Kooperatif Tipe STAD Berbantuan Wordwall pada Peserta Didik Kelas III A SD Negeri 11 Mataram Nurul Fitriani; I Nyoman Karma; Diani Pratiwi
Jurnal Pendidikan, Sains, Geologi, dan Geofisika (GeoScienceEd Journal) Vol. 7 No. 1 (2026): Februari

Abstract

This study aimed to examine the implementation of the Student Teams Achievement Division (STAD) cooperative learning model supported by Wordwall media in improving students’ participation and learning outcomes. The research subjects consisted of 25 third-grade students of class IIIA at SD Negeri 11 Mataram. This study employed Classroom Action Research (CAR) based on the Kemmis and McTaggart model, which includes the stages of planning, acting, observing, and reflecting, and was conducted over two learning cycles. The research instruments comprised observation sheets and individual evaluation tests. The results indicated an improvement in students’ learning participation. The level of learning participation in the pre-cycle stage was 59%, which increased to 74% in the first cycle and further rose to 87% in the second cycle. The increase in learning participation had a positive impact on students’ learning outcomes, which showed progressive improvement. In the pre-cycle stage, the average learning outcome score was 73. This score increased to an average of 80.5 in the first cycle and showed a significant improvement to 86 in the second cycle. Based on these findings, the STAD cooperative learning model assisted by Wordwall media can serve as an effective solution to enhance student participation and create an enjoyable learning environment during the learning process, thereby improving learning outcomes.
Analisis Kemampuan Representasi Peserta Didik Pada Praktikum Kimia Materi Asam Basa Kelas Xi Sains SMAN 2 Mataram Nurul Fitriani; Muntari Muntari; Dodiy Firmansyah
Chemistry Education Practice Vol. 8 No. 2 (2025): Edisi November

Abstract

This study aims to analyze the chemical representation abilities of students at the macroscopic, submicroscopic, and symbolic levels in acid-base material practicums in class XI Science of SMAN 2 Mataram. The type of research is descriptive quantitative. The study population was 288 students of class XI SMAN 2 Mataram. The research sample was selected using purposive sampling technique obtained by class XI Science 7 students totaling 36 students and class XI Science 8 students totaling 36 students. Data collection techniques used interview, observation, documentation, and test instruments. Data analysis used N-gain percentage. The results showed that students' initial chemical representation abilities were relatively low, with an average pretest of 34.50% (macroscopic), 31.00% (submicroscopic), and 35.00% (symbolic). After the lab-based learning, posttest results showed significant improvements at all levels of representation, namely 85.25% (macroscopic), 78.25% (submicroscopic), and 76.50% (symbolic). The average total improvement increased from 33.50% to 79.99%, and is considered good. These results indicate that the chemistry lab is effective in improving students' representational skills on acid-base material.
